The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ring Software Engineering sk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 16 May 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
16 May 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 16 20 15
Rank change year-on-year +4 -5 +2
Permanent jobs citing Software Engineering 5,491 3,442 7,739
As % of all permanent jobs in England 6.75% 8.79% 9.20%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 9.15% 9.41% 10.81%
Number of salaries quoted 4,055 2,409 6,335
10th Percentile £48,289 £43,750 £40,000
25th Percentile £56,250 £55,000 £47,644
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£72,500 £72,500 £62,500
Median % change year-on-year - +16.00% -13.79%
75th Percentile £95,000 £102,500 £85,000
90th Percentile £100,000 £125,000 £112,500
UK median annual salary £70,000 £72,500 £62,500
% change year-on-year -3.45% +16.00% -10.71%
